PURPOSE AND OBJECTIVES


SAP HANA & Analytics in the SAP board area Technology & Innovation (T&I) is at the core of SAP’s vision to create the intelligent enterprise for our customers. Data management and the value it creates through automation, intelligent systems, and actionable analytical insights are critical to the success of any business.
It is the organization’s purpose to give the data superpower to every business and every professional, to connect the value chain of data, and make any data available all over the business via inspiring analytical insights.
This is realized by bringing the powerful capabilities of SAP HANA and SAP’s analytics solutions together in new products, thereby allowing users and businesses to harness the potential of the full data value chain – anywhere, at any time, and from any device.
The SAP HANA & Analytics portfolio, comprising SAP’s broad range of database (SAP HANA) and analytics solutions, has always been extremely relevant for SAP. In today’s data-driven world, where the amount of data increases every day, it will gain even more in importance.
The SAP HANA & Analytics communications team is responsible for defining and steering all internal communications tasks and assets for the entire organization, as well as for providing the required insights and information for all units within the organization and beyond – through all adequate communication assets, written channels, as well as events.
An intern / working student belonging to the SAP HANA & Analytics communications team will be directly involved in highly visible events, communications tasks visible to a broad audience (ranging from all SAP HANA & Analytics employees to the SAP Executive board), and will, above all, gain first-hand insights into some of SAP’s newest flagship and key products (e.g. SAP HANA Cloud).

 

EXPECTATIONS AND TASKS

 

  • Support day-to-day communications activities in the team, such as blogging or writing newsletters
  • Drive a dedicated communications project
  • Support quarterly organization-wide events, such as all-hands meetings, coffee corner sessions
  • Drive event management and communications activities pertaining to the organization, execution, and post-processing of the SAP Analytics & Data Day such as:
    • Content management and call for papers / speakers (as central PoC)
    • Creation of agenda based on content tracks, room capacity, speaker availability
    • Marketing and communication to sponsors, speakers, and attendees
    • Registration management based on room capacity, waiting lists, last-minute changes
    • Feedback survey and evaluation
    • Collection and rollout of videos and pictures after the event
    • Claiming expenses, accepting invoices, sharing costs
